引言
手游行业近年来发展迅猛,成为了全球娱乐产业的重要组成部分。随着技术的不断进步,手游系统也日益复杂和完善。本文将深入揭秘手游系统背后的秘密,带你了解游戏是如何运作的,以及如何更好地畅游虚拟世界。
一、手游系统的构成
手游系统主要由以下几个部分构成:
1. 游戏引擎
游戏引擎是手游系统的核心,负责图形渲染、物理引擎、音效处理等。常见的游戏引擎有Unity、Unreal Engine等。游戏引擎的性能直接影响游戏的流畅度和画面质量。
2. 网络通信
手游需要通过网络进行数据传输,包括角色状态、游戏数据等。网络通信技术包括TCP/IP、WebSocket等。良好的网络通信技术可以保证游戏体验的稳定性。
3. 服务器架构
服务器负责处理玩家的请求,如角色创建、游戏数据存储等。服务器架构分为单机服务器、分布式服务器和云服务器。分布式服务器可以提供更高的并发处理能力和更稳定的游戏体验。
4. 用户界面
用户界面是玩家与游戏交互的桥梁,包括角色、界面布局、交互逻辑等。优秀的用户界面设计可以提高玩家的游戏体验。
二、手游系统的关键技术
1. 游戏引擎技术
游戏引擎技术是手游开发的基础。以下是一些关键技术:
- 3D渲染技术:实现游戏场景和角色的三维效果。
- 物理引擎:模拟游戏中的物理现象,如碰撞、重力等。
- AI技术:实现游戏角色的智能行为。
2. 网络通信技术
网络通信技术是手游系统稳定运行的关键。以下是一些关键技术:
- WebSocket:实现实时通信,提高游戏交互性。
- P2P技术:降低服务器压力,提高游戏性能。
3. 服务器技术
服务器技术是手游系统高效运行的基础。以下是一些关键技术:
- 负载均衡:合理分配服务器资源,提高服务器性能。
- 数据库优化:提高数据读写速度,保证游戏数据的安全性。
三、手游系统的优化策略
1. 游戏优化
- 图形优化:降低游戏画面复杂度,提高运行效率。
- 音效优化:降低音效文件大小,提高音效质量。
2. 网络优化
- 降低网络延迟:优化网络协议,提高数据传输速度。
- 优化服务器架构:采用分布式服务器,提高并发处理能力。
3. 用户界面优化
- 界面美观:提高用户界面美观度,提升游戏体验。
- 交互优化:简化操作流程,提高玩家上手速度。
四、总结
手游系统是手游行业的基石,深入了解手游系统的工作原理和关键技术,有助于我们更好地理解和享受游戏。随着科技的不断发展,手游系统将更加完善,为我们带来更加精彩的虚拟世界体验。
